Season 5 Episodes

The runaway runway hit opens its fifth season with 16 fresh designers on pins and needles: They try to make it work by creating clothes from unusual sources.


The designers participate in a green-themed challenge. Natalie Portman serves as the guest judge.


The sights, sounds and styles of New York City serve as the designers' inspiration. Sandra Bernhard is the guest judge.

Episode 4. Rings of Glory (Air Date: NA)

The designers must create a sports-themed outfit. Olympic speed skater Apolo Anton Ohno is the guest judge.


Brooke Shields is the guest judge in a challenge that requires the designers to create a day-to-night look for professional women.

Episode 6. Good Queen Fun (Air Date: NA)

RuPaul is the guest judge in a challenge that tasks the designers to create flamboyant attire for drag queens.


The designers create clothes using various car parts. Stylist Rachel Zoe and Season 3 contestant Laura Bennett serve as guest judges.


The designers must create looks inspired by fashion icon and guest judge Diane von Furstenberg's fall line. The contestants must also base their creations on the 1948 film "A Foreign Affair." Fashion figure Fern Mallis serves as guest judge.


The designers reach for the stars when they create clothes based on astrological signs. Designer Francisco Costa is the guest judge.


The contestants fashion clothes for college women, helping them make a smooth transition from cool-school style to working-world sophistication. Designer Cynthia Rowley is the guest judge.


Rapper-actor LL Cool J is on hand as the guest judge when the designers try to hit all the right notes in a music-themed challenge.

Episode 12. Nature Calls (Air Date: NA)

In a nature-themed undertaking, the remaining designers take a jaunt to the great outdoors to draw inspiration. But will they see the forest for the trees?

Episode 13. Finale Part 1 (Air Date: NA)

The series begins to sew up its fifth season with Part 1 of the two-part finale, in which the remaining contestants prepare to showcase their designs at New York's Fashion Week.


The final designers are on pins and needles as the winning contestant is revealed in the conclusion of the Season 5 finale. Tim Gunn serves as the guest judge.
